Expiration Date and Safe Usage Period

Graco recommends that you replace your SnugRide 35 car seat after seven years from its manufacturing date․ This date is usually found on a label located on the back of the car seat․ Using a car seat beyond this date significantly increases the risk of it failing to protect your child adequately in the event of a collision․ The materials degrade over time, and the car seat might not meet current safety standards․ Even without visible damage, internal components can weaken․ Do not attempt to extend the car seat’s lifespan beyond the recommended seven years․ Discarding an expired car seat is crucial for your child’s safety․ If you are unsure about the manufacturing date, contact Graco customer service for assistance․ Remember, a new car seat provides the best protection for your precious child․

Base Installation Instructions

Securely attach the base to your vehicle’s lower anchors or seat belt․ Ensure a tight fit with no slack․ The Graco SnugRide 35 manual provides detailed diagrams and instructions for both LATCH and seat belt installation․ Proper base installation is crucial for optimal safety․ Check for a firm connection; the base should not move more than one inch side-to-side or front-to-back․ If using LATCH, ensure the lower anchors are properly engaged and the top tether strap (if applicable) is secured to the vehicle’s designated tether anchor point․ For seat belt installation, route the vehicle’s seat belt through the designated slots on the base, ensuring the belt is snug and properly locked․ Refer to the vehicle owner’s manual for additional guidance on your vehicle’s specific LATCH system or seat belt configuration․ Always double-check your installation before placing your child in the car seat․ Incorrect installation compromises the safety features of the car seat and increases the risk of injury in an accident․ Consult the manual for visual guidance and further clarification on the installation process․

Vehicle Belt Installation Instructions (with and without base)

The Graco SnugRide 35 can be installed with or without the base using your vehicle’s seat belt․ For baseless installation, route the vehicle’s seat belt through the designated belt path on the car seat, ensuring a snug and secure fit․ Tighten the belt until you cannot move the car seat more than one inch side-to-side or front-to-back․ The manual provides illustrations for proper belt routing․ If using the base, follow the base installation instructions first, then attach the car seat to the installed base․ Ensure a secure connection between the car seat and the base․ Always refer to the vehicle owner’s manual for specific instructions about your car’s seat belt system․ European belt routing may be an option; consult the manual for details․ Never use a damaged or improperly functioning seat belt․ Improper installation significantly increases the risk of injury in a collision․ Always double-check your installation before each use to guarantee a secure and safe fit for your child․

Cleaning Instructions for Fabric and Harness

To clean the fabric, spot-clean with a mild detergent and water solution, then air dry completely․ Never use bleach or harsh chemicals, as these can damage the fabric and compromise the car seat’s structural integrity․ For more extensive cleaning, consult your Graco SnugRide 35 manual for specific instructions on removing and washing the cover․ Always ensure the cover is completely dry before reinstalling it on the car seat․ The harness straps should be cleaned regularly as well․ Wipe them down with a damp cloth and mild soap․ Avoid submerging the harness in water, as this could damage the internal components․ Make sure the straps are completely dry before using the car seat again․ Proper cleaning and maintenance will help your car seat last longer and stay in optimal condition, keeping your little one safe and secure during every journey․ Always refer to your instruction manual for detailed information on cleaning and care instructions․

Care and Storage of the Car Seat

Proper care and storage are crucial for extending the lifespan and maintaining the safety of your Graco SnugRide 35 car seat․ Avoid prolonged exposure to direct sunlight or extreme temperatures, as this can degrade the materials․ When not in use, store the car seat in a cool, dry place away from any sharp objects that could damage the fabric or structure․ If storing for an extended period, ensure it’s clean and dry to prevent mold or mildew growth․ Regularly inspect the car seat for any signs of wear and tear, such as frayed straps or damaged fabric․ If you notice any damage, immediately contact Graco customer service for guidance on repair or replacement․ Remember to always check the expiration date on the car seat label; Graco recommends replacing the seat after seven years from its manufacture date․ Following these guidelines helps ensure your child’s safety while maximizing the car seat’s service life․
